The research project titled "The Use of 3D Printing Technology in Prosthodontics for Dental Restorations and Implants" aims to explore the application of 3D printing technology in the field of prosthodontics, specifically focusing on dental restorations and implants. This research overview provides a detailed explanation of the project, highlighting the significance, objectives, methodology, and expected findings. **Significance of the Study:** Prosthodontics is a specialized branch of dentistry focused on the restoration and replacement of teeth. Traditional methods for creating dental prosthetics can be time-consuming, labor-intensive, and may not always result in precise and customized solutions for patients. The integration of 3D printing technology in prosthodontics has the potential to revolutionize the field by offering more efficient, cost-effective, and patient-specific solutions for dental restorations and implants. **Objectives of the Study:** The primary objective of this research is to investigate the effectiveness and feasibility of using 3D printing technology in prosthodontics for creating dental restorations and implants. Specific objectives include assessing the accuracy and precision of 3D-printed prosthetics, evaluating the cost-effectiveness of 3D printing compared to traditional methods, and exploring patient satisfaction and clinical outcomes associated with 3D-printed dental prosthetics. **Methodology:** The research methodology will involve a combination of literature review, case studies, and possibly clinical trials. A comprehensive review of existing literature on 3D printing in prosthodontics will be conducted to provide a theoretical foundation for the study. Case studies will be used to examine real-world applications of 3D printing technology in creating dental restorations and implants. Depending on the resources available, clinical trials may be conducted to assess the performance and patient acceptance of 3D-printed dental prosthetics. **Expected Findings:** It is anticipated that this research will demonstrate the potential benefits of 3D printing technology in prosthodontics, including improved accuracy, customization, and efficiency in creating dental restorations and implants. The findings of this study may contribute to the growing body of evidence supporting the adoption of 3D printing in dental practice and may help guide future research and clinical implementation in this field.
